The question I have is......600 at the crank or 600 at the wheel?

Because it is possible to hit close to 600 at the crank on a stock cube LS1 with a killer head cam combo. This would put you at about 510whp with a 15% drivetrain loss. There are a couple of guys with 500whp on stock cubes here on ls1tech, but it is extremely rare.
